Sources: The #Jaguars and standout TE Brenton Strange have agreed to a 3-year extension worth up to $48M with $25M guaranteed — per his agents Jim Ivler, JR Roggio, and Jon Perzley of @SPORTSTARSNYC.
The Penn State product caught 46 passes for 540 yards and 3 TDs in 12 games last season, becoming a key part of Trevor Lawrence and Jacksonville’s offensive scheme.

The #Browns have added longtime NFL executive Trent Baalke in a consultant-like capacity, a source tells @CBSSports.
Was most recently general manager of the #Jaguars from 2021-24. Was also a GM with the #49ers from 2011-16.
Six-time Pro-Bowl DE Calais Campbell, who played in Baltimore from 2020-2022, is returning to sign a one-year deal with the Ravens, per source. Campbell will 40 on Sept. 1 and this will be his 19th NFL season.

Jaguars signed Travon Walker to a four-year, $110 million extension that includes $77M guaranteed and $50M fully guaranteed at signing, per @eliteloyaltysp.
